CVE-2019-25688 affects Kados R10 GreenBee with an SQL injection vulnerability in the menu_lev1 parameter. The vulnerability allows unauthenticated attackers to manipulate database queries by injecting malicious SQL code. Attackers can craft requests to extract sensitive database information or modify database contents. The vulnerability enables unauthorized access to the database without requiring authentication. This represents a critical security flaw that could lead to data compromise and unauthorized system access.
